II.1.1) Title
Debt, Welfare and Housing Information and Advice Services
Reference number: DN639255
II.1.2) Main CPV code
75200000
II.1.3) Type of contract
Services
II.1.4) Short description
This contract is for the provision of a Debt, Welfare and Housing information and advice service within the Borough of Blackburn with Darwen. In addition, there is the requirement to provide 2 appropriately experienced staff to be a part of a council team, headed by the Benefits Service to implement a government led Supported Housing Improvement Programme. Included in the programme will be the review of supported housing accommodation quality, and for the provision of transitionary support to assist residents with moving into, and maintaining more permanent mainstream accommodation.
